Curious if you’d be willing to share: does Stripe have a team dedicated to awesome API improvements like this or do teams own their own endpoints/APIs and just stick to specific guidelines?
-
-
-
That’s super awesome! I haven’t really seen any other API’s implement this before. We did something similar recently with a _warnings key. Would love to borrow this idea and link to relevant docs as wellhttps://www.geocod.io/docs/#warnings
End of conversation
New conversation -
-
-
Great error messages demonstrate the maturity of the team implementing the API. Shows understanding of the API state space, failure modes, empathy for users/non-experts, methodical implementation.


Thanks. Twitter will use this to make your timeline better. UndoUndo
-
-
-
Shouldn't the RESTfulness of APIs obviate the need for client SDKs (at least on some platforms)?
Thanks. Twitter will use this to make your timeline better. UndoUndo
-
-
-
The debug url is a simple but brilliant idea
Thanks. Twitter will use this to make your timeline better. UndoUndo
-
-
-
React also does this in a smart way, they display warnings in the console and put a reference to that specific error under the /warnings URL path (for e.g https://reactjs.org/warnings/special-props.html …)
Thanks. Twitter will use this to make your timeline better. UndoUndo
-
-
-
My jaw drops a little more each day in response to the maturity and beauty of stripe's offers. I work in payments and stripe has been for many years the gold standard.
Thanks. Twitter will use this to make your timeline better. UndoUndo
-
Loading seems to be taking a while.
Twitter may be over capacity or experiencing a momentary hiccup. Try again or visit Twitter Status for more information.